Microsoft's Optical Computer Breakthrough: A New Era in Efficiency
Real Estate News:Microsoft CEO Satya Nadella recently celebrated the company's breakthrough work in optical computers, emphasizing its potential to solve complex real-world problems with far greater efficiency. In a post on X (formerly known as Twitter), Nadella announced that Microsoft’s research on an analog optical computer has been published in the scientific journal Nature. “Our breakthrough work on an analog optical computer points to new ways to solve complex real-world problems with much greater efficiency. Super to see this published today in @Nature,” he wrote in the post.

The project, as explained by Microsoft in its newsroom, was carried out by a small Microsoft Research team that has been working for the past four years to design a computer that uses light instead of electricity for calculations. The group set out to build the system with widely available components such as micro-LED lights, optical lenses, and smartphone camera sensors, making it easier to manufacture in the future.

Unlike digital computers that process information in binary code, the analog optical computer uses physical properties of light to perform calculations. Microsoft said the device could, in theory, solve certain classes of problems 100 times faster and with 100 times less energy than conventional machines. The team tested the computer on optimization problems, which are common in industries such as finance, logistics, and healthcare. These include complex banking transactions and medical imaging scans, both of which require sorting through vast numbers of possibilities to find the best solution.

Researchers also said the technology could eventually be applied to artificial intelligence. Running AI models on such a system could use far less energy than the GPUs currently powering large language models, while also delivering faster performance. Microsoft stated that the work remains at a research stage, but the publication in Nature marks a milestone in exploring new approaches to computing.

Frequently Asked Questions

What is an analog optical computer?

An analog optical computer is a type of computer that uses light instead of electricity to perform calculations. It leverages the physical properties of light to process information, potentially offering significant improvements in speed and energy efficiency.

How is Microsoft's optical computer different from traditional digital computers?

Traditional digital computers use binary code (0s and 1s) to process information. In contrast, Microsoft's analog optical computer uses light and its physical properties to perform calculations, which can be much faster and more energy-efficient for certain types of problems.

What are the potential applications of this technology?

The technology could be applied to various industries, including finance, logistics, and healthcare, where it can solve complex optimization problems more efficiently. Additionally, it has significant potential in the field of artificial intelligence, where it could reduce energy consumption and improve performance of AI models.

How does this breakthrough impact the future of computing?

This breakthrough marks a significant step in the development of more efficient and sustainable computing technologies. It could lead to new approaches in solving complex real-world problems, potentially revolutionizing industries and reducing the environmental impact of computing.

What is the current status of this research?

The research is currently at a research stage, and the findings have been published in the scientific journal Nature. While it is a significant milestone, further development and testing are needed before the technology can be widely adopted and integrated into commercial applications.
